鸿蒙生态机遇与挑战
方向一:阐述对鸿蒙生态的认知和了解,并对鸿蒙生态的崛起进行简要分析
从开发者角度来看,鸿蒙生态是一个充满机遇的新兴领域。
首先,鸿蒙系统打破了设备之间的壁垒,带来了跨设备的无缝体验。例如,在开发一款智能家居控制应用时,用户可以在智能手机上轻松设置各种参数,然后在智能手表上快速查看设备状态,这种跨设备的交互为应用开发拓展了全新的维度。开发者能够利用这种特性,打造出更具整合性的应用,满足用户在不同场景下使用不同设备的需求。
多屏协同是鸿蒙生态的又一亮点。以办公场景为例,开发者可以设计应用,使得用户在手机、平板和电脑之间实现高效协同。在开发文档编辑类应用时,用户可以在手机上记录灵感,然后在平板上进一步整理,最后在电脑上完成详细编辑,过程中数据实时同步,极大地提高了工作效率。这让开发者有机会创造出更多依赖多屏协同功能的创新应用。
鸿蒙的开发工具也为开发者提供了便利。例如,其简洁易用的集成开发环境,拥有丰富的文档和示例代码。在我自己的开发实践中,学习成本相对较低,能够快速上手并开发出简单的应用原型。而且,鸿蒙的开发工具还在不断更新和优化,为开发者提供更高效的开发流程,比如代码自动补全功能更加智能,调试工具也更加稳定,这些都有助于提高开发效率和质量。
鸿蒙生态的崛起主要得益于其对万物互联理念的践行。在当前数字化时代,用户拥有多种智能设备,对设备间的互联互通有强烈需求。鸿蒙系统正好满足了这一需求,吸引了众多厂商加入,从而形成了一个庞大的生态系统,为开发者创造了广阔的市场空间和无限的可能性。
从开发者角度来看,鸿蒙生态是一个充满机遇的新兴领域。
首先,鸿蒙系统打破了设备之间的壁垒,带来了跨设备的无缝体验。例如,在开发一款智能家居控制应用时,用户可以在智能手机上轻松设置各种参数,然后在智能手表上快速查看设备状态,这种跨设备的交互为应用开发拓展了全新的维度。开发者能够利用这种特性,打造出更具整合性的应用,满足用户在不同场景下使用不同设备的需求。
多屏协同是鸿蒙生态的又一亮点。以办公场景为例,开发者可以设计应用,使得用户在手机、平板和电脑之间实现高效协同。在开发文档编辑类应用时,用户可以在手机上记录灵感,然后在平板上进一步整理,最后在电脑上完成详细编辑,过程中数据实时同步,极大地提高了工作效率。这让开发者有机会创造出更多依赖多屏协同功能的创新应用。
鸿蒙的开发工具也为开发者提供了便利。例如,其简洁易用的集成开发环境,拥有丰富的文档和示例代码。在我自己的开发实践中,学习成本相对较低,能够快速上手并开发出简单的应用原型。而且,鸿蒙的开发工具还在不断更新和优化,为开发者提供更高效的开发流程,比如代码自动补全功能更加智能,调试工具也更加稳定,这些都有助于提高开发效率和质量。
鸿蒙生态的崛起主要得益于其对万物互联理念的践行。在当前数字化时代,用户拥有多种智能设备,对设备间的互联互通有强烈需求。鸿蒙系统正好满足了这一需求,吸引了众多厂商加入,从而形成了一个庞大的生态系统,为开发者创造了广阔的市场空间和无限的可能性。
方向二:分享在鸿蒙生态下开发时遇到的挑战
在鸿蒙生态开发过程中,确实面临着一些挑战。
开发工具不完善是其中之一。尽管鸿蒙的开发工具在不断改进,但在某些复杂功能的开发上,仍然存在一些不足。例如,在处理大规模图形渲染的应用开发时,开发工具可能会出现卡顿现象,影响开发效率。针对这一问题,我首先积极向鸿蒙官方社区反馈问题,同时通过优化代码结构来缓解工具的压力。比如,将图形渲染代码进行模块化处理,减少不必要的资源占用,提高工具的运行稳定性。
技术难度也是一大挑战。鸿蒙系统有其独特的架构和技术特点,如分布式软总线技术等。在理解和应用这些技术时,需要花费大量的时间和精力。为了克服这个问题,我深入学习官方文档和技术指南,参加鸿蒙官方举办的线上线下培训课程。同时,积极与其他开发者交流,参与技术论坛讨论,通过实际案例和经验分享,逐渐掌握这些复杂技术。
生态竞争方面,虽然鸿蒙生态发展迅速,但在应用市场上仍面临来自安卓和 iOS 的竞争。这就要求开发者开发出更具特色的鸿蒙应用。在开发过程中,我注重挖掘鸿蒙生态的独特优势,如前面提到的跨设备体验和多屏协同功能。通过这些功能,打造出区别于其他平台应用的独特卖点,吸引用户选择鸿蒙版本的应用。
面对这些挑战,开发者要保持积极的学习态度,善于利用官方资源和社区力量,不断优化自己的开发方法和策略,才能在鸿蒙生态开发中抓住机遇。
方向三:阐述对于鸿蒙生态未来的发展趋势的看法
鸿蒙生态在未来各个行业领域有着广阔的应用前景和丰富的创新点。
在智能手机领域,随着鸿蒙系统的不断优化,其流畅度和安全性将进一步提升。开发者可以利用新的系统特性,开发出更具个性化的手机应用,如结合 AI 技术的智能助手应用,能够根据用户的使用习惯自动调整手机设置和推荐相关内容。
在智能穿戴方面,鸿蒙生态将推动健康监测类应用的创新。例如,开发能够实时监测心率、血压等多项健康数据,并与手机、家庭医疗设备等其他设备联动的应用。当检测到异常数据时,可以自动向预设的联系人发送信息并提供建议,实现更加智能化的健康管理。
对于车载系统,鸿蒙生态可以实现车辆与智能手机、智能交通系统的深度融合。开发者可以开发出具有导航、车辆信息监测、娱乐等多功能一体化的车载应用。例如,根据实时交通数据和用户的出行习惯规划最佳路线,同时与车内娱乐系统无缝切换,提供更好的驾乘体验。
在家居领域,鸿蒙生态将使智能家居更加智能和便捷。开发者可以创建更复杂的场景模式应用,比如根据不同的时间、天气和用户的情绪自动调整室内灯光、温度、音乐等。
对于开发者而言,要积极关注这些行业发展趋势。一方面,要不断学习新的技术,如物联网、AI 等相关技术,将其融入到鸿蒙应用开发中。另一方面,要加强与不同行业的合作,深入了解用户需求,开发出真正符合市场需求的应用。同时,鸿蒙生态的发展也需要开发者积极反馈问题和建议,共同推动生态的完善和发展,从而在这个广阔的市场空间中创造更多有价值的应用,开拓新的技术领域。
更多推荐



所有评论(0)